Employee Assistance Program
A work-based intervention program designed to assist employees in resolving personal problems that may impact their job performance, health, and well-being.
Burnout
A state of emotional, physical, and mental exhaustion caused by prolonged stress, typically from the workplace.
Eustress
Positive stress that results from engaging in challenges that are perceived as within one's ability to manage or overcome.
Distress
A state of emotional, mental, or physical strain or tension resulting from adverse or demanding circumstances.
